The United States Marine Propeller Shaft Market size was valued at USD 3.5 Billion in 2022 and is projected to reach USD 4.8 Billion by 2030, growing at a CAGR of 4.2% from 2024 to 2030.
The United States Marine Propeller Shaft Market is crucial to the marine industry, encompassing the components responsible for transferring power from the engine to the propeller. This market has seen continuous advancements, particularly in the development of durable materials and designs to improve efficiency. Rising demand for maritime transport and the expansion of naval and commercial vessels have driven growth. The market is influenced by regulations focusing on reducing emissions and enhancing fuel efficiency. Additionally, the need for high-performance propeller shafts in both new and retrofit applications further fuels this market's expansion. Technological innovations, like corrosion-resistant coatings and lightweight materials, also contribute to its growth. With growing investments in the marine sector, the market is expected to thrive. The demand for high-quality propeller shafts remains steady as both the private and public sectors invest in maritime infrastructure.

The United States Marine Propeller Shaft Market is geographically diverse, with key regions contributing significantly to the overall market share. The East Coast, with its major ports and active shipping routes, is a crucial area for market growth. The Gulf Coast, known for its oil and gas industry, also plays a vital role in demand, particularly in offshore vessels. The West Coast, with its thriving commercial and naval fleets, presents significant opportunities for growth. Additionally, regions involved in recreational boating and tourism, such as the Great Lakes and Florida, are expected to see increased demand. Regional regulations and environmental standards vary, influencing market dynamics in each area. Manufacturers must adapt to local requirements and consumer preferences. The ongoing development of port infrastructure across the country also supports growth in regional markets. As demand for naval defense and commercial vessels grows, different regions will continue to see varying levels of market penetration.
Technological advancements are driving the evolution of the United States Marine Propeller Shaft Market. Innovations in materials, such as the use of high-strength alloys and corrosion-resistant coatings, have enhanced the durability and efficiency of propeller shafts. The introduction of digital monitoring systems, including sensors and IoT technology, has improved real-time performance tracking and predictive maintenance. Additionally, developments in lightweight and composite materials have made propeller shafts more fuel-efficient and cost-effective. The evolution of hybrid and electric propulsion systems has also influenced the design of new propeller shafts. Furthermore, advancements in 3D printing and additive manufacturing offer the potential for custom-made, on-demand propeller shafts. The industry continues to shift toward automation, improving production efficiency and reducing costs. As technology continues to evolve, the market will likely see more sustainable, high-performance solutions that meet the growing demand for environmentally friendly maritime transport.
